5 months withheld salaries: NAAT declares nationwide protest
THE National Association of Academic Technologists, NAAT, on Wednesday announced a nationwide protest over the five months withheld salaries and unfulfilled agreements with the Federal Government.

Obong Victor Attah to lead PANDEF committee in resolving Wike-Fubara rift, Niger Delta crisis
The Pan-Niger Delta Forum (PANDEF) has announced that a High-Level Peace and Reconciliation Committee led by Chief Obong Victor Attah, former Governor of Akwa Ibom State, has been established to address ongoing tensions between Federal Capital Territory Minister Nyesom Wike and Rivers State Governor Siminalayi Fubara, as well as other conflicts in the Niger Delta.
